The fight is not over for the Southern Ocean!





Today is a sad day for the Southern Ocean. CCAMLR’s (Commission for the Conservation of Antarctic Marine Living Resources) commitment to the global community to create large-scale marine reserves in the Southern Ocean was dishonoured today. We are deeply disappointed.

But rest assured the fight is not over. For the second time in thirty years, CCAMLR has agreed to hold a “special extraordinary” meeting in July to focus on reaching agreement on marine protection areas (MPAs) in the Southern Ocean.
